Renowned Malayalam actor TP Madhavan has passed away at the age of 88. He was undergoing treatment in a private hospital in Kollam, Kerala, where he breathed his last due to age-related health complications. His death has left a deep void in the Malayalam film industry, with colleagues and fans mourning the loss of this veteran actor. TP Madhavan was a prominent figure in Malayalam cinema, having worked in more than 600 films. He began his acting career relatively late, at the age of 40, but soon made a name for himself with his powerful performances. His first break came in 1975 when actor Madhu cast him in the film Ragam. Madhavan’s last on-screen appearance was in the 2016 movieDays, a gripping emotional suspense thriller. Despite facing tough times in his later years, Madhavan continued to pursue his passion for acting. He lived in Gandhi Bhavan, Pathanapuram, for the last eight years, after moving there from a lodge in Thiruvananthapuram. A television serial director had helped him transition to Gandhi Bhavan, where he spent his final years. Even during these difficult times, he remained dedicated to acting, playing roles in TV serials and films. Some of his notable television appearances include Moonumani, Priyamani, Valayam, Ente Manasaputhri, and Daya. His death has sent a wave of sorrow through the Malayalam film industry. Kerala’s Chief Minister Pinarayi Vijayan expressed his grief over Madhavan’s death. In his condolence message, he described Madhavan as a talented actor who portrayed a wide range of characters in over 600 films. The Chief Minister also recalled Madhavan's continuous dedication to his craft, even during his later years at Gandhi Bhavan, where he continued to act in television serials.
